The cheapest way to get from El Neusa to Bogotá is to drive which costs $1 - $2 and takes 32 min.
The fastest way to get from El Neusa to Bogotá is to taxi which takes 32 min and costs $16 - $20.
The distance between El Neusa and Bogotá is 55 km. The road distance is 26.6 km.
The best way to get from El Neusa to Bogotá without a car is to taxi and bus which takes 1h 16m and costs $11 - $19.
It takes approximately 1h 16m to get from El Neusa to Bogotá,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between El Neusa to Bogotá is 27 km. It takes approximately 32 min to drive from El Neusa to Bogotá.

There is no direct connection from El Neusa to Bogotá. However, you can take the taxi to Guasca then take the bus to Bogotá Cl. 72 Cra. 13 bus. Alternatively, you can then take the taxi to Bogotá - Portal del Norte.
